  • Abstract
    We present herein the development of a fully 360° rotatable fluorescence tomography system for small animals without the use of source and detector fibers, or optically matching fluids. The setup consists of a cooled CCD camera coupled to a wide-angle objective and an axially moveable, collimated laser source integrated within a rotating light-tight chamber. The system´s capability to acquire and reconstruct high density datasets is demonstrated with experimental results from phantoms.
